 | In this study, three antibody clones available from Leinco Technologies (Table 1) were tested for their ability to bind and visualize mpox virus in cell cultures. The work was
performed in the lab of Dr. John Connor <http://www.connorlab.com/>, which focuses on understanding how the virus-host interaction works and methods to tip the balance in favor of the host. To do this they aim to determine how viruses hijack infected cells, and how cells defend themselves against viral infection. |

 | Lot-to-lot reproducible monoclonal antibodies against mouse cell-specific proteins and cytokines are paramount for reproducible results. Depletion can occur naturally or be induced for treatment purposes. Therefore, it is a useful tool in therapeutic, immunotherapy and diagnostic research. It is common practice for researchers to use antibodies to remove a specific cell type to infer its function and mouse cell depletion in vivo experiments are used to establish the role of specific cell types in a variety of immunological processes. Many of these antibodies have been developed by academic and government labs all over the world and have been reported and referenced for use in in vivo studies to deplete a specific cell type. |

 | mAbMods™ recombinant antibodies have been engineered to have identical antigen binding variable domains to those of the traditional clones from which they are derived, but the IgG constant regions have been engineered to be of mouse origin. This reduces immunogenic responses in the mouse which can lead to adverse immunological reactions and gradual loss of activity. |

 | 3Helixs Collagen Hybridising Peptide (CHP) is a synthetic peptide that can specifically bind to denatured collagen by structural recognition of exposed alpha-strands. Their in vivo
CHP is conjugated to a near-infrared dye to enable accurate and reliable measurements of collagen turnover in live animal models. |

 | Abnova provides a nanoCAR-T mRNA service that advances CAR-T cell therapy by integrating its NanoAb™ VHH antibody platform, mRNA IVT technology, and lipid nanoparticle (LNP) delivery. This approach allows precise ex vivo delivery of CAR instructions to T cells via mRNA encapsulated in ionizable lipid nanoparticles. |
